Life Enrichment Manager
Hours: Exempt, min. 40 hours/weekLocation | Department: Chelsea Retirement Community | Independent LivingOverviewThe Life Enrichment Manager ensures that residents within Independent Living are engaged in activities of interest. This position is responsible for planning, scheduling, and coordinating meaningful activities appropriate to the needs and interests of residents.What You’ll DoPlan, schedule, and implement a diverse program of classes, events and programs based on resident’s interests and needs.Use the Dimensions of Wellness to provide a wide range of quality programs, both active and passive, to serve our active residents.Work closely with the Life Enrichment Assistant to coordinate programs.Develop meaningful, person-centered relationships with the residents, their families, team members and guests.Perform administrative requirements such as reports, budget preparation and monitoring of expenses, payroll, and program surveys.Proficient in Microsoft Office (Word, Outlook, and Excel) with the ability to learn new applications.Must be willing to work some weekends and evenings to meet the needs of residents and fellow team members.Coordinate programs with other departments as necessary.Serve of various committees and appointed.What It TakesMust possess, as a minimum, an Associate Degree.
